At the core of effective learning lies the concept of spaced repetition, a method that optimally times the review of information to combat the forgetting curve. According to learning experts, systems like the one developed by Math Academy utilize spaced repetition not just for mastering concepts and procedures, but also for retaining factual information such as definitions, theorems, and formulas. However, the process of memory retention is not instantaneous. As noted by Justin Skycak, transitioning from uncertainty to confidence in recalling information can take several weeks. This timeline emphasizes the importance of consistent practice, particularly through retrieval exercises.

Retrieval practice involves actively recalling information from memory rather than passively reviewing reference material. This technique is essential for solidifying memories and ensuring that knowledge is not only acquired but also retained over the long term. Engaging in retrieval practice can slow down the forgetting process, thereby extending the duration of memory retention. By challenging oneself to recall information, learners can strengthen their neural pathways, making future retrieval easier and more efficient.

In parallel with these cognitive strategies, technological innovations can further enhance our learning and development capabilities. One such tool is Pocketbase, an open-source backend solution that simplifies the development process. Its unique architecture allows developers to host everything in a single file, making it both easy to deploy and manage. Pocketbase integrates a web server, server-side JavaScript, and a SQLite database, enabling users to efficiently handle data without the complexity typically associated with backend development.
